Output ddae34936a12980455b1779c20956ec74c6bd5d8cb45c5462f16636c7c090e5f:1

value
2354338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 028f703495558254c400923a0cd0ddc8922a4952 OP_EQUAL
address
31vZ7CHXCtRzhST2Rw732AoxaKFJHBG8j1
transaction
ddae34936a12980455b1779c20956ec74c6bd5d8cb45c5462f16636c7c090e5f
spent
true